Alzheimer's and mental deterioration caregivers prepare to aid your elderly liked ones Around 5. 5 million Americans over the age of 65 are impacted by Alzheimer's illness and other forms of mental deterioration. Mental deterioration is an umbrella term that defines degenerative cognitive illness, such as Alzheimer's, that affect memory and cognitive capability gradually.
Quickly those affected will certainly forget familiar faces and ultimately lose the capacity for basic self-care. Those with Alzheimer's and various other kinds of mental deterioration require consistent like live securely, and it is best for them to get care at home in an acquainted setting. Our caregivers have gotten additional training to properly care for those in any type of stage of Alzheimer's and various other kinds of dementia in their homes.
Those impacted by these conditions experience disability in thinking that can adversely impact their every day lives and interaction with others. It is essential to recognize that the term "dementia" does not refer to a certain illness. It refers even more to the signs and symptoms that happen in conditions such as Alzheimer's in which those influenced lose their memory and experiential knowledge.

Caring for somebody with Alzheimer's disease or an additional sort of dementia can be a long, demanding, and extremely psychological trip. However you're not the only one. In the United States, there are even more than 16 million individuals taking care of someone with mental deterioration, and many millions extra all over the world. As there is currently no remedy for Alzheimer's or mental deterioration, it is commonly your caregiving and support that makes the greatest distinction to your liked one's lifestyle.
Seeking help and assistance along the road is not a deluxe; it's a need. Equally as each person with Alzheimer's illness or mental deterioration proceeds in different ways, so as well can the caregiving experience differ commonly from one person to another. Nevertheless, there are strategies that can help you as a caretaker and help make your caregiving journey as satisfying as it is testing.
